Engine Options and Powertrain
The 2024 Z4 is expected to offer a range of powertrain options, catering to diverse preferences and driving styles. Different engine configurations will affect not only the car’s performance but also its fuel efficiency.
Engine Type | Horsepower | Torque (lb-ft) | 0-60 mph (estimated) |
---|---|---|---|
2.0L Turbocharged I4 | 255 hp | 295 lb-ft | 6.0 seconds |
3.0L Turbocharged I6 | 387 hp | 369 lb-ft | 4.5 seconds |
Potential M Performance variant (speculative) | 450+ hp | 450+ lb-ft | 3.5 seconds |
Note: Figures are estimations based on industry trends and previous BMW models. Final specifications will be confirmed by the manufacturer closer to the launch date.
